CROPTHORNE MAIN STREET (north west side) The Old Post Office

11.2.65.

GV II Circa 1600. Timber frame and plaster. Single storey and attics. Modern casements. Two ledged doors, one with weather hood. Thatch roof with eaves that rise over upper windows.

The Manor, The Old Post Office and Manor Cottage form a group. Listing NGR: SO9994445024
